Excel高级函数使用IF和MAXIFS到满足条件的最大值
Excel是一款功能强大的电子表格软件,拥有多种高级函数可以帮助用户进行复杂的数据分析和计算。其中,IF函数和MAXIFS函数是常用的两个函数,通过它们的结合使用,可以快速到满足条件的最大值。本文将介绍如何使用IF和MAXIFS函数,以实现这一功能。
一、IF函数的使用
IF函数是Excel中的逻辑函数,其基本语法为:
IF(条件, 返回值1, 返回值2)
其中,条件为待判断的逻辑条件,返回值1为满足条件时的返回结果,返回值2为不满足条件时的返回结果。
例如,我们有一列数据A1:A5,需要判断其中哪些数值大于等于10,可以使用IF函数进行如下操作:
在B1单元格中输入以下公式:
=IF(A1>=10, A1, "")
将公式填充至B2:B5单元格。
这样,B1:B5单元格中将显示满足条件的数值,不满足条件的单元格则为空。
二、MAXIFS函数的使用
MAXIFS函数是Excel 2016及以上版本中的一个新增函数,它可以根据多个条件,到满足条件的最大值。MAXIFS函数的基本语法为:
MAXIFS(最大值范围, 条件范围1, 条件1, 条件范围2, 条件2, …)
其中,最大值范围为需要寻最大值的数据范围,条件范围和条件用于指定筛选数据的条件。
例如,我们有一张销售数据表格,其中A列是产品名称,B列是产品销量,C列是产品类型。我们希望到销量最大的某一类产品,并显示其名称和销量。可以使用MAXIFS函数进行如下操作:
在E1单元格中输入以下公式:
=MAXIFS(B1:B10, C1:C10, "某一类产品")
在F1单元格中输入以下公式:
=INDEX(A1:A10, MATCH(E1, B1:B10, 0))
这样,E1单元格中将显示满足条件的最大销量,F1单元格中将显示对应的产品名称。
三、使用IF和MAXIFS函数到满足条件的最大值
结合IF和MAXIFS函数,我们可以到满足条件的最大值。例如,我们有一张学生成绩表格,其中A列是学生姓名,B列是数学成绩,C列是英语成绩。我们希望到数学成绩和英语成绩都大于80分的学生,并显示其姓名和最高成绩。可以使用IF和MAXIFS函数进行如下操作:
在E1单元格中输入以下公式:
=IF(AND(B1>80, C1>80), MAXIFS(B1:C10, A1:A10, A1), "")
excel常用的函数有哪些
将公式填充至E2:E10单元格。
这样,E1:E10单元格中将显示满足条件的学生姓名,且其最高成绩为数学成绩和英语成绩中的较高值。不满足条件的单元格则为空。
通过以上操作,我们可以灵活运用IF和MAXIFS函数,快速到满足条件的最大值。Excel的高级函数为数据处理和分析提供了强大的工具,让用户能够更加高效地进行数据处理和决策。希望本文的介绍能对你学习Excel高级函数有所帮助。

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。